Luz Restaurant
Culinary excellence in the heart of Launceston
Luz Restaurant, previously located in the The Grand Hotel, has moved their exceptional fine-dining experience to the former location of Northern Club on Cameron Street. Chef and co-owner Louis brings over 25 years experience and has worked in some of the top Michelin star restaurants around the world including Gordon Ramsay and the Pourcel brothers in France. Having returned to his Tasmanian roots here in Launceston, he brings his vision of giving diners superb food memories utilising the freshest of the amazing local produce Tasmania has on offer.
Whether you are celebrating a special occasion with loved ones, or wanting an exceptional meal for no occasion at all, diners can expect to enjoy world-class food and service in an intimate environment.
WHY WE LOVE IT
1. Their carefully considered menu evolves with the seasons, featuring fresh Tasmanian ingredients.
2. The heritage-listed location adds another touch of elegance to the dining experience.
3. The sumptuous combination of Australian fine dining in an intimate European-style bistro setting.
